Resumo: Production of rock biofertilizers is a practical process with reduction of energy consumption and increasing nutrients availability in soils. A field experiment was carried out applying P and K biofertilizers from phosphate rock (Apatite-PR) and potash rock (biotite-KR) plus sulfur inoculated with Acidithiobacillus, on lettuce (cv. Crespa) in two consecutive crops with the aim do evaluate the agronomic efficiency and the residual effect of P biofertilizers in levels (BP0, BP1, BP2 e BP3) and SSP (simple super phosphate in recommended level) and K biofertilizers in levels (BK0, BK1, BK2 e BK3) and KCl (potassium chloride in recommended level), on lettuce and in some soil attributes. Level 1 is equivalent to 50% recommendation, 2 recommended level to lettuce and 3 is 150% of recommended level based in soil analyses. A control treatment was added without P and K (P0K0). Nitrogen was applied as basic fertilization in the conventional form used in the Cariri region (storm compound in level 600 mg/m2). The experiment was carried out in a representative soil of the Cariri region, with low available P and medium available K. The plant was cropped following the conventional system for lettuce. On plants were evaluated fresh biomass and dry biomass in shoots, plant height, number of leaves, commercial evaluation, total P and total K on shootdry biomass, and in soil were determined pH, available P and K in soil. In both crops the best results of lettuce yield were obtained when applied TSP, KCl, P and K biofertilizers in level BP2BK3. In reference to the effect of fertilization in pH values it was not observed significant response compared to pH in the natural soil, with greater reduction when applied SSP. Although in the second crop was evident the positive response of the biofertilizers, especially the residual effect when applied the P and K rock biofertilizers in treatment BP2BK3 showing that they may be alternative for substitution of soluble mineral fertilizers to lettuce in soil withlow available P and medium available K.

Com biofertilizantes produzidos a partir de rochas fosfatadas (RP) e potássicas (RK) com adição de S inoculado com Acidithiobacillus (S*) realizou-se um experimento em campo, no esquema fatorial 52, no delineamento em blocos casualizados, com 4 repetições. Foram realizados dois plantios consecutivos com alface (cv. Crespa), para avaliar a eficiência e o poder residual de biofertilizante fosfatado nos níveis (BP0, BP1, BP2 e BP3) e SFS (superfosfato simples no nível recomendado) e níveis de biofertilizante potássico (BK0, BK1, BK2 e BK3) e KCl (cloreto de potássio no nível recomendado), em atributos na planta e no solo. O nível 1 equivale a 50% do recomendado, o nível 2 ao recomendado e o nível 3 equivalente a 150% a da recomendação com base na análise do solo. Como adubação básica aplicou-se vermicomposto de minhoca (600g m-2). O experimento foi conduzido em solo representativo da região do Cariri (Crato-CE), com baixo nível de P e médio de K. Na planta avaliou-se a biomassa fresca e seca da parte aérea, altura, nº de folhas e avaliação comercial, P e K total na parte aérea, e no solo determinou-se o pH, P e K disponível. No primeiro e no segundo cicloos melhores resultados de produção de alface foram obtidos com a aplicação de SFT e KCL e com os biofertilizantes BP e BK no nível equivalente ao recomendado. No segundo ciclo ficou evidenciada a resposta positiva dos biofertilizantes BP e BK. Os biofertilizantes de rochas com P e K no tratamento BP2BK3, de uma maneira geral apresentou o melhor resultado. Com referência ao efeito da fertilização no pH não foi observado efeito significativo em relação ao pH do solo natural, com redução mais acentuada quando aplicado o SFS. O poder residual (segundo ciclo) mostrou melhor resposta dos biofertilizantes no nível BP2BK3 no P e K disponível do solo.
